Since 1979, the Choose Your Own Adventure gamebooks have been supplying readers with a wide assortment of imagination-fueled tales. Radio Silence’s Matt Bettinelli-Olpin and Tyler Gillett (Ready or Not) will direct and produce an adaptation of the series for the big screen from a script by Tom Bissell (Andor). 20th Century Studios is backing the upcoming film.

This unique series of gamebooks was mostly aimed at children. They tell nonlinear stories that allow readers to make choices that will affect the book’s overall outcome. The idea was first used in Bantam Books’ The Cave of Time by Edward Packard. But the idea really took hold in the late 1990s, with 184 titles being published from 1997 to 1999. Many readers like ourselves probably grew up with R. L. Stine’s Give Yourself Goosebumps spin-off series.
While this will be the first attempt to officially adapt Choose Your Own Adventure gamebooks for the silver screen, there have been other takes on the idea. Black Mirror: Bandersnatch adapted the concept using Netflix’s built-in interactive interface.
